| The Hell Gate Bridge, the world's longest steel arch bridge, crosses Hell Gate, Ward's Island, Randall's Island, and Bronx Hills to New York. It is 1,000 feet long with 200-foot high concrete towers, costing $15,000,000. Operated by the New York Connecting Railroad, it allows through trains of the N. Y., N. H. & H. R. R. to connect with Pennsylvania R. R. for south or west travel without changing in New York. |
